icon Up with Literacy! (+1)  
It has recently come to our attention that certain player roles are illiterate, which means that when trying to read a scroll all letters are replaced by periods. I think this is silly. If the architect wants to simulate illiteracy, all the architect needs to do is have scrolls contain a variable.
And the assignment of literacy is somewhat arbitrary. I mean, maybe I want my rock golems to be smarter in the Iceworks levels since their brains are silicon. Maybe I'm playing a mutant spider.

icon Re: Up with Literacy! (0)  
MeckMeck GRE wrote:
IMO every character should be literate. No Imperatives and no simulated illiteracy. Honestly, I think it's one of the most worthless features of Drod that you can't read a scroll as a roach or as a wubba. My vote for "literacy for everyone"!
Eehhh...sure. Let's change this behavior for 3.1. It was one of the earlier features I was trying out for alternate player roles before the ability to change the text on scrolls was implemented (iirc). So I'll say every role can be literate, and if the architect doesn't want it that way for specific instances, they can design their hold that way.
